The Prometric examination commonly refers to the qualifying assessment conducted on behalf of the Saudi Council for Health Services. The test is so called since it is conducted by Prometric, an American firm which provides comprehensive assessment services for its Saudi client.
Prometric itself is a fully owned subsidiary of Educational Testing Service and provides technology-enabled assessment options through its test centres spread across more than 160 countries.
The Prometric exam is mandatory for nurses and indeed all medical and allied health professionals to obtain their certificate before they can apply for a licence or work visa. The test for nurses assesses them under two broad categories: Nurse Specialist and Nurse Technician. BSc nurses with three years of experience are eligible to appear for the Nurse Specialist exam, while GNM and BSc nurses with experience of two years may take the Nurse Technician exam. The test results are valid for three years.
